Adams House, Liberty Avenue, Richmond, Wayne County, IN

Significance: This handsome Greek Revival-style house, with unusual segmentally arched dormers, was built between ca. 1830 and 1843. Survey number: HABS IN-111

R. G. Adams House, Mackeys Creek vicinity, Tishomingo, Tishomingo County, MS

R. G. Adams House, Mackeys Creek vicinity, Tishomingo, Tishomingo Coun...

Significance: The Adams House is a good, late, example of a frame double pen (two-room) plan with open central hall, or "dogtrot," a folk house type indigenous to the rural South. Built in 1913, with a rear el... More
